Какое означают JSON-формат и XML
JavaScript-Object-Notation плюс XML-формат представляют по-сути форматы передачи сведениями, что задействуются с-целью отправки данных для различными системами. Данные-стандарты используются во веб-разработке, связке сервисов, взаимодействии с API и размещении структурированных данных. Ключевая задача указанных стандартов состоит в том, для-того-чтобы обеспечить удобный а-также типовой способ описания сведений.
В онлайн экосистеме сведения должны передаваться между приложениями плюс серверными-частями, а дополнительно между разными программами. Во практических случаях а-также практических материалах, включая Азино 777, обычно объясняется, каким-образом JSON-формат а-также Extensible-Markup-Language применяются для настройки обмена информацией, согласования данных плюс связи для платформами.
Каков означает JavaScript-Object-Notation
JSON, либо JavaScript Object Notation, представляет из-себя легковесный способ данных, основанный на-основе схеме структур и массивов. JSON задействует Азино символьный формат, он удобно разбирается и обрабатывается и пользователем, так-же плюс приложениями. JavaScript-Object-Notation активно применяется во онлайн-сервисах плюс интерфейсах-API.
Информация внутри JSON структурированы во формате комбинаций ключ-значение. Ключ представляет собой обозначение параметра, и значение способно быть строкой, цифровым-значением, булевым типом, массивом или вложенным элементом. Такая модель делает этот-формат подходящим ради размещения а-также передачи сведений.
JSON-формат выделяется лаконичностью плюс понятностью. Он не предполагает сложных правил оформления, вследствие-этого его проще использовать во сравнении с альтернативными структурами. Данный-фактор делает формат популярным выбором Азино777 ради актуальных систем.
Что означает XML-формат
Extensible-Markup-Language, или гибкий markup Language, образует собой формат разметки, что применяется для хранения и пересылки данных. Данный-формат построен на-основе задействовании тегов, которые обозначают схему данных. XML-формат позволяет задавать пользовательские элементы плюс указывать элементов содержимое.
Информация во XML-формате оборачиваются внутрь теги, что имеют начальную и финальную часть. Данная организация создает данный-стандарт значительно формальным плюс строгим. XML задействуется для многочисленных решениях, где требуется точное представление организации данных Азино 777.
XML характеризуется гибкостью плюс гибкостью. Он дает-возможность задавать многоуровневые схемы а-также задействовать дополнительные-свойства с-целью конкретизации данных. Такая-возможность формирует XML подходящим для задач, когда требуется строгая организация информации.
Основные расхождения JSON и XML
JavaScript-Object-Notation а-также XML закрывают похожую функцию, но получают различные принципы ко передаче данных. JavaScript-Object-Notation использует намного понятный способ-записи плюс меньше знаков, это создает формат кратким. XML предполагает увеличенное-число разметочных частей, что расширяет объем сведений.
JSON-формат удобнее воспринимается и эффективнее обрабатывается для многих нынешних приложений. XML, со своей очередь, предоставляет более-широкие возможностей для задания структуры плюс валидации информации. Определение Азино между форматами формируется с-учетом условий определенной системы.
Кроме-того отличается механизм взаимодействия через данными. JSON обычно применяется для web-разработке и интерфейсах-API, при-этом как XML-формат задействуется в enterprise платформах, документации и передаче структурированной сведениями.
Схема JSON-формата
JSON формируется на-основе структур а-также списков. Объект обозначает из-себя набор комбинаций key-value, заключенных во curly скобки. Набор представляет собой перечень значений, помещенных во служебные скобки.
Каждое значение в JSON имеет-возможность являться элементарным либо многоуровневым. Базовые Азино777 значения содержат текст, числовые-значения и логические значения. Сложные элементы охватывают наборы и вложенные элементы. Подобная организация помогает представлять сложные информацию.
JavaScript-Object-Notation не предусматривает комментарии и строгую типовую-проверку, данный-фактор облегчает JSON применение. Тем-не-менее это нуждается-в внимательности во-время взаимодействии со сведениями, для-того-чтобы предотвратить неточностей.
Организация Extensible-Markup-Language
XML задействует древовидную схему, построенную вокруг дочерних элементах. Отдельный элемент имеет название и имеет-возможность Азино 777 включать данные или другие элементы. Это помогает создавать многоуровневые структуры данных.
Элементы Extensible-Markup-Language могут включать параметры, которые конкретизируют информацию. Параметры помещаются на-уровне стартового тега плюс добавляют вспомогательный этап описания.
Extensible-Markup-Language нуждается-в строгого следования условий структурирования. Каждые теги должны быть оформлены, а структура обязана быть корректной. Такая-особенность создает данный-стандарт намного формальным, при-этом создает надежность информации.
Области-применения JSON-формата
JSON широко применяется для онлайн-сервисах. Данный-формат Азино применяется с-целью передачи данных для пользовательской-частью и серверной-частью, и также ради взаимодействия со API-интерфейсами. Из-за собственной понятности он считается стандартом для актуальных системах.
JSON используется для мобильных решениях, сервисах аналитики и интеграции платформ. Данный-формат помогает эффективно отправлять информацию плюс обрабатывать сведения без многоэтапных конвертаций.
Кроме-того JSON-формат применяется ради хранения настроек и настроек. Его структура создает формат удобным для сохранения параметров а-также данных повторного Азино777 чтения.
Использование XML
Extensible-Markup-Language задействуется во решениях, где требуется строгая схема данных. XML задействуется во enterprise решениях, передаче документами плюс связке нескольких платформ.
XML-формат часто используется во стандартах пересылки информацией, таких как системные файлы, записи плюс данные. Данный-формат гибкость дает-возможность настраивать схему под-задачи различные случаи.
Дополнительно XML-формат задействуется во решениях, в-которых важна проверка данных. Существуют служебные описания, которые дают-возможность проверять корректность организации а-также информации.
Плюсы плюс недостатки
JSON-формат имеет совокупность плюсов, такие-как легкость, компактность а-также быстроту анализа. Данный-формат удобен для специалистов плюс хорошо используется для актуальных сервисов. Однако Азино 777 его средства задания структуры ограничены.
XML-формат дает более развитые возможности ради контроля информации. Данный-формат содержит схемы, параметры а-также жесткую организацию. Такая-особенность делает XML удобным с-целью многоуровневых систем, но расширяет размер данных и трудоемкость интерпретации.
Подбор среди JSON и Extensible-Markup-Language формируется с-учетом требований. В-случае-если требуется скорость плюс понятность, чаще применяется JavaScript-Object-Notation. В-случае-если критична строгая структура а-также валидация информации, используется XML-формат.
Разбор JSON и Extensible-Markup-Language
Ради взаимодействия через JSON и Extensible-Markup-Language применяются специальные инструменты и пакеты. Они позволяют разбирать, записывать и конвертировать данные. Во многих технологий кодинга имеется встроенная совместимость этих Азино форматов.
Интерпретация JavaScript-Object-Notation как-правило эффективнее, так-как как JSON организация легче. Extensible-Markup-Language нуждается-в больше ресурсов по-причине развитой организации а-также нужды контроля разметки.
Преобразование данных среди структурами также возможно. Данный-подход позволяет объединять сервисы, применяющие разные форматы. Такие процессы часто проводятся самостоятельно посредством помощью специальных библиотек Азино777.
Значение JSON а-также XML-формата во современных решениях
JSON-формат и XML-формат выступают ключевыми частями цифровой инфраструктуры. Эти-форматы поддерживают пересылку сведениями между системами а-также помогают разрабатывать подключения. При-отсутствии этих форматов взаимодействие среди системами было бы значительно труднее.
JSON является главным форматом ради онлайн-сервисов и API благодаря данной понятности плюс практичности. XML сохраняет свою актуальность в системах, в-которых нужна строгая организация а-также валидация информации.
Оба формата дальше применяться плюс эволюционировать. Данные-форматы остаются ключевыми средствами ради пересылки сведений а-также формирования онлайн Азино 777 систем.
Дополнительные черты форматов
JSON-формат и Extensible-Markup-Language отличаются не-только исключительно синтаксисом, но а-также моделью ко обработке через данными. JSON-формат чаще используется в-роли способ передачи, тогда как Extensible-Markup-Language имеет-возможность использоваться как с-целью отправки, так-же и для хранения сведений. Данный-фактор связано из-за тем-фактом, что XML помогает описывать намного сложные модели а-также условия валидации.
В JavaScript-Object-Notation не-предусмотрена поддержка комментариев, это создает формат более лаконичным с точки подхода схемы. Внутри Extensible-Markup-Language Азино комментарии разрешаются, это облегчает пояснение сведений. При-этом такой-подход также расширяет массу плюс имеет-возможность усложнять анализ.
Дополнительно важной чертой является зависимость ко case. Внутри JSON-формате названия строги относительно case, что предполагает аккуратности при взаимодействии. Внутри XML еще необходимо контролировать правильное оформление элементов, так-как как ошибка внутри имени способна привести к ошибочной обработке.
Скорость и результативность
JSON-формат обычно разбирается оперативнее, так-как потому-что JSON организация проще плюс нуждается-в меньше вычислений. Это Азино777 особенно значимо при обработке при крупными массивами информации и значительными активностями. JSON регулярно используется во системах, где критична оперативность отклика.
XML-формат предполагает увеличенного-объема мощностей ради интерпретации, поскольку потому-что нужно проверять схему тегов а-также проверять элементов валидность. Тем-не-менее это покрывается способностью строгой проверки сведений плюс гибкостью схемы.
В-процессе определении стандарта критично принимать-во-внимание требования проекта. В-случае-если главным-фактором считается скорость и малый-объем, как-правило задействуется JSON. В-случае-если важна четкая-организация и проверка информации, применяется Азино 777 XML-формат.